River Po Delta Region

Chapter
Publication Date:
2021
abstract:
What is the future of the Veneto region given the threats posed by rising sea levels, heavy rainfall, floods and drought?
Three regional territories are reimagined in 2100 by taking multiple water-based threats and opportunities as the starting point. Widening the riverbeds, establishing spatial corridors to buffer peak water flow, replenishing the groundwater through the use of new reservoirs, storing water to counteract periods of drought, leaving room for the interplay of the rivers and the sea, and accommodating the rising seawater levels are all strategies for shaping a more resilient Veneto.
